Is there criteria for the "First Four"? Are they generally the last 8 at large?
Found it. It would suck not getting past the First Four, but if you do, you might have a slight advantage by getting a game under your belt.
Each night’s action will pit two No. 16 seeds battling for the right to play a second-round game against a top-seeded team. Those games will be followed by contests featuring two of the last four at-large teams selected to the field. All four games will be broadcast on Turner Broadcasting’s truTV..
